The Coalition Warrior Interoperability Exercise in Poland brought together 3,000 participants from more than 40 countries, including more than 100 Romanian military personnel.

Between June 2 and June 20, more than 100 Romanian military personnel participated in the Coalition Warrior Interoperability eXploration, eXperimentation, eXamination (CWIX25) exercise in Poland. This exercise, led by Allied Command Transformation, involved 3,000 participants from over 40 nations. CWIX is crucial for testing communications and information technology systems, with the aim of improving interoperability between allied forces. Romania's participation helps modernize national capabilities in the fields of defense and communications.
